Select Brand:

Show All



£28.13

Dispatch on next business day

£1.95

Dispatch on next business day

£6.73

Dispatch on next business day

£7.54

Dispatch on next business day

£11.40

Dispatch on next business day

£3.83

Dispatch on next business day

£3.86

Dispatch on next business day

£5.51

Dispatch on next business day

£12.75

Dispatch on next business day

£40.23

Dispatch on next business day

£36.14

Dispatch on next business day